Output 28307d3c70eceb81264e5e11e92b07632c813e74ea9c9395374fb8568f01d505:0

value
525360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d7465e429e31132e15416d92dd2242e8a0dbb9d OP_EQUAL
address
32vA9WirUs33Mkx8nmUaVCNXxbyRqWxdgS
transaction
28307d3c70eceb81264e5e11e92b07632c813e74ea9c9395374fb8568f01d505
spent
true